Solution Overview

Problem

Existing engine valve systems have a fixed valve movement, which cannot adjust valve lift and duration according to operational conditions, making it difficult to balance power and economy in varying load conditions.

Innovation Solution

A continuously variable valve lift system with a driving swing arm, camshaft, and adjusting swing arm, allowing for adjustable valve lift and duration through a simple structure that includes a torsion spring and rolling friction contact with the camshaft, enabling the engine to adapt to different load conditions by changing the contact position between the roller rocker arm and the driving arc surface.

AI summary

Disclosed are a continuously variable valve lift system and an automobile comprising same. The continuously variable valve lift system comprises a driving swing arm (20), a camshaft (50) and a valve mechanism (60), wherein the valve mechanism (60) comprises a roller rocker arm (61) and a valve (62) which is connected to the roller rocker arm (61), the driving swing arm (20) comprises a driving surface (21), and the driving surface (21) makes contact with the roller rocker arm (61) so as to drive the valve (62) to perform reciprocating motion. The continuously variable valve lift system further comprises a control shaft (10) and an adjustment swing arm (30), wherein the driving swing arm (20) is sleeved on the control shaft (10) and can swing around the control shaft (10), a fixed part (11) is provided on the control shaft (10), the fixed part (11) is fixed on the control shaft (10), the adjustment swing arm (30) is connected on the fixed part (11) and can swing relative to the fixed part (11), the adjustment swing arm (30) is provided between the camshaft (50) and the driving swing arm (20), and two sides of the adjustment swing arm (30) respectively make contact with the camshaft (50) and the driving swing arm (20).
